Carrie Elks has done it again! I loved reading about how Josh and Holly's relationship blossomed throughout this book after 8 years apart via a story of battle of love for a small town on a side of the mountain. I loved the storyline, the writing, the relationship built between Josh and Holly but also between Josh and Holly's cousins/family. I also enjoyed the relationship development between Holly and her mum.

So, this book I found to have a slow beginng and wasn't the fast-paced book I was used to. I think this is due to me reading the books in the wrong order; reader-error! Also, this is probably down to Elks setting up the backstory of Winterville. As you get further through the book, the pace sped up a lot the further you read the book. Personally, I devoured the last two thirds of the book in one afternoon/evening!

100% recommend*!

4/5 Stars.

*Just remember to start with this book, not the others in the story. Don't make my mistake!*
